Commands:
Paragraph > New Movie...
Paragraph > Delete Movie
Embedded Menu > Export
Embedded Menu > Continuous Text Flow
Embedded Menu > Block Text Flow
Embedded Menu > Position
A movie is inserted into the current paragraph when selecting the command Paragraph > New Movie.... You need to select a movie file in the Finder. The movie is copied to the document.
The movie can be scaled by a pinch gesture. It can be moved by dragging it to another location within the same paragraph. The movie can be opened and edited by double clicking onto the movie.
At the left-upper corner of the movie is a small menu icon which gives access to the commands to change the text flow and to export the movie. The menu command Export exports the movie, the menu commands Continuous Text Flow and Block Text Flow change the text flow around the movie. If the Text Flow is continuous the movie is either left or right aligned to the the paragraph border depending on to which it is closest moved to.
The command Position allows to precisely position and scale the movie within the paragraph.
A movie file can be dropped into a paragraph.
A movie can be copy-pasted into other paragraphs.
After selection the movie can be deleted with the command Paragraph > Delete Movie. The deletion is undoable
